Bonefishing is written about almost entirely in the Caribbean, and the fish that literature describes is *Albula vulpes*. The Indo-Pacific has its own, and on the Pacific atolls where the flats fishery is most celebrated it is usually this one.
*Albula glossodonta* is a reef-associated and brackish-tolerant fish of shallow water — FishBase gives 0 to 20 m — from the Red Sea to Hawaii and the Tuamotus, north to southern Japan, south to Lord Howe, throughout Micronesia. It reaches 90 cm and 8.6 kg, which is larger than the Atlantic species commonly runs.
It behaves as bonefish do, which is why the fishery exists: it moves onto shallow sand and coral flats with the tide to root for crustaceans and molluscs, tailing in water sometimes barely deep enough to cover it, and it is caught by sight-casting a small fly or lure ahead of a moving fish. It is famously fast when hooked and famously difficult to approach.
**It is assessed by the IUCN as Vulnerable**, on a criterion of observed reduction, and that is the fact that ought to change how it is written about. Atoll bonefish populations are small, local and reachable — a flat is a finite thing — and the fishery that has grown around them is almost entirely catch-and-release for exactly that reason. Where it is not, it is netted.
So the practical content is short: this is a release fishery, the fish is Vulnerable, and how it is handled in the last thirty seconds decides whether releasing it meant anything.

- The bonefish outline: bright silver, streamlined, with a conical snout overhanging a low sucker-like mouth for rooting in sand.
- A rounded lower jaw, which is what the English name refers to and what separates it from its congeners.
- No teeth visible in the jaws — the crushing surfaces are on the tongue and palate.
- Larger than the Atlantic bonefish commonly runs: FishBase records 90 cm and 8.6 kg.
- Range settles it in practice: this is the bonefish of the Indo-Pacific and Albula vulpes is the one of the western Atlantic.

Lifecycle and reproduction
Reef-associated and brackish-tolerant over a depth range of 0 to 20 m, moving onto shallow sand and coral flats with the tide and off them as it falls. Medium resilience. Atoll populations are small and geographically confined, which is central to the conservation assessment.
Bonefishes pass through a leptocephalus larval stage, which is unusual outside the eels and is part of why their population structure is hard to read. The specifics for this species are not established on the FishBase record and are not supplied from the family.
Feeding and senses
Roots in sand and rubble for crustaceans, molluscs and worms, tilting head-down so the tail breaks the surface — the tailing behaviour the whole sight fishery is built on. It crushes hard prey with plates on the tongue and palate rather than with jaw teeth.
Extremely sensitive to vibration and to shadow in shallow water, and hunting largely by scent and touch in the sand. That combination is what makes the fishing difficult: the fish cannot see a fly well and can detect a footfall on a flat from a long way off.
Through the year
Available year-round on tropical flats, with the fishing governed by TIDE rather than by season — fish move onto the flat as it floods and off as it drains, and the window is a few hours rather than a few months.

Why anglers care
The flats fish of the Indo-Pacific and the target of a substantial fly and light-lure fishery across the Pacific atolls, sight-cast to moving or tailing fish on a flooding tide. It runs extremely fast when hooked, which is most of its reputation. It is assessed as Vulnerable with atoll populations that are small and local, and the sport fishery for it is almost entirely catch-and-release — which is a decision the species' status justifies rather than an affectation.
Handling and returning
Keep it in the water. A bonefish played hard in warm shallow water is exhausted and vulnerable to sharks on release, so revive it facing into the current until it swims off under its own power rather than letting it go the moment it is unhooked. Wet hands, barbless hooks, and no lifting a fish out for a photograph if it can be avoided.
Safety
Fish welfare — Can cause injury needing treatment
A Vulnerable species in a fishery built on release. A bonefish played to exhaustion in warm shallow water and let go immediately is a fish that will often be taken by a shark within minutes — so a release that looks successful frequently is not.
What reduces it: Play the fish as quickly as the tackle allows rather than prolonging it, keep it in the water throughout, use barbless hooks, and hold it facing into the current until it swims off strongly under its own power. Move on from a flat rather than fishing it repeatedly.

Bonefish
Albula glossodonta has a rounded lower jaw, reaches 90 cm and 8.6 kg, and ranges from the Red Sea to Hawaii and the Tuamotus; Albula vulpes is the western Atlantic species that the great majority of English-language bonefishing literature describes. The Indo-Pacific fish is assessed Vulnerable and the Atlantic one is assessed separately.
